Lenovo quarterly sales flat, profits up on premium PC growth

2020-02-20 08:57:00| Telecompaper Headlines

(Telecompaper) Lenovo reported sales unchanged year-on-year for its fiscal third quarter to December, at USD 14.1 billion. Operating profit was still up 12 percent to USD 488 million, thanks to strength in premium PCs and profitability at its mobile business. Net profit increased 11 percent to USD 258 million. The company said it was seeing some impact on its supply chain and production due to the coronavirus outbreak, but would leverage its global footprint to minimise the effect on results.
